Output 03bafc0bc305f6647cabb53c813d23eba8b69ae3a0a43f52d7a74eb3457caef7:1

value
101648170
script pubkey
OP_0 OP_PUSHBYTES_20 945b65b9e1432445968cbee0981d9f810ff75b5e
address
ltc1qj3dktw0pgvjyt95vhmsfs8vlsy8lwk67jsrl4r
transaction
03bafc0bc305f6647cabb53c813d23eba8b69ae3a0a43f52d7a74eb3457caef7
spent
true